The Four Packaging Decisions That Impact EPR Fees

Extended Producer Responsibility (EPR) programs are spreading, and they're changing how packaging gets priced. Under these programs, the fees a producer pays are shaped directly by packaging design- which means the choices packaging teams make today increasingly determine what they'll owe tomorrow. The good news is that most programs reward the same basic packaging improvements, so a few well-chosen design moves can lower exposure across the board, often without a full redesign. How the Fees Work 

Most EPR programs are built around a base fee that's adjusted up or down- a mechanism called eco-modulation. Lighter, recyclable, mono-material, and simpler designs tend to earn lower fees. Heavier, multilayer, mixed-material, and hard-to-sort formats tend to cost more. For most packaging in most of these states, one organization, the Circular Action Alliance (CAA), handles registration, reporting, and fees, which makes it a practical first stop for confirming what applies where you sell. In most cases, four packaging decisions drive most of that difference. * 

  1. Use Less Material Weight is one of the biggest levers. Because fees are largely a function of material type and weight, using less material is the most direct way to lower what you owe- and some programs are now moving beyond incentives to require outright reductions in both material weight and component count. Reduction should reach every element, not just the primary structure: labels, liners, tear strips, seals, and film layers all add up. Small savings, multiplied across millions of units, become significant.
  2. Design for Recyclability Recyclability is the next major driver. Packages that move cleanly through existing recycling streams earn lower fees; those that combine polymer families or are hard to sort are penalized. That's why so many teams are shifting toward mono-material and recycle-ready structures- designs that satisfy recyclability goals and cut fee exposure at the same time. Industry groups like the Sustainable Packaging Coalition (SPC), a project of the nonprofit GreenBlue, publish practical guidance for designing recycle-ready packaging and communicating recyclability clearly, which makes those goals easier to hit and to prove. The Association of Plastic Recyclers (APR) also provides widely used design guidance and testing protocols that help companies evaluate whether a package is compatible with existing recycling systems.
  3. Consolidate and Reduce Components Every added part carries a cost: more material, more complexity, and more to sort at end of life. Multi-part and multilayer designs sit consistently among the higher-fee categories. The opportunity isn't simply to review components; it's to determine where they can be eliminated or combined. Can several functions- easy-open, resealable, tamper-evident- be delivered through fewer parts, or built into the package itself, without sacrificing performance?   4. Use PCR Strategically Post-consumer recycled (PCR) content earns lower fees and counts toward compliance, so it belongs in the toolkit. But it's a supporting move, not a substitute. PCR doesn't offset high material use or a poorly structured, hard-to-recycle package. Reducing weight and designing for recyclability come first; PCR is most effective when it's part of a package that's already designed with reduction and recyclability in mind.
